The 16th studio album by Diana Ross & The Supremes, Let the Sunshine In was issued by Motown in 1969. Included is the sequel to the previous year’s #1 hit “Love Child”, “I’m Livin’ in Shame,” as well as the Smokey Robinson song “The Composer,” which hit at #27 in the charts. The album had been originally prepared to by titled “No Matter What Sign You Are,” but this was changed after that tune failed to chart. It features Diana Ross, Mary Wilson and Cindy Birdsong, but original Supreme Florence Ballard appears instead of Birdsong in two tracks (“Let the Music Play” and “What Becomes of a Broken Heart”) that date from 1966-67 sessions.
